Abstract
The crystal structure of 1-phenyl-3-methyl-5-[2′-(4"- henylmethoxylphenyl)ethoxyl] pyrazole, a potential JH mimic, has been established; the crystal belongs to the triclinic system with z = 2, and the distance between C(25) and H{14) (19.64A), an important steric factor, which is very near the optimum value (21A) for JH activity expression, may yield an explanation to the potential bioactivity of the new pyrazole compound.
